    Dimer-dimer stacking interactions are important for nucleic acid binding by the archaeal chromatin protein Alba

    No full text
    Archaea use a variety of small basic proteins to package their DNA. One of the most widespread and highly conserved is the Alba (Sso10b) protein. Alba interacts with both DNA and RNA in vitro, and we show in the present study that it binds more tightly to dsDNA (double-stranded DNA) than to either ssDNA (single-stranded DNA) or RNA. The Alba protein is dimeric in solution, and forms distinct ordered complexes with DNA that have been visualized by electron microscopy studies; these studies suggest that, on binding dsDNA, the protein forms extended helical protein fibres. An end-to-end association of consecutive Alba dimers is suggested by the presence of a dimer-dimer interface in crystal structures of Alba from several species, and by the strong conservation of the interface residues, centred on Are and Phe(60). In the present study we map perturbation of the polypeptide backbone of Alba upon binding to DNA and RNA by NMR, and demonstrate the central role of Phe(60) in forming the dimer dimer interface.     First person – Alba Delrio-Lorenzo

    No full text
    First Person is a series of interviews with the first authors of a selection of papers published in Journal of Cell Science, helping early-career researchers promote themselves alongside their papers. Alba Delrio-Lorenzo is first author on ‘Sarcoplasmic reticulum Ca2+ decreases with age and correlates with the decline in muscle function in Drosophila’, published in JCS.     Libri e lettori (tra autori e personaggi). Studi in onore di Mariolina Bertini

    No full text
    Un volume che, parlando proprio di libri e di letture, rispecchia le scelte e le passioni di una grande studiosa come Mariolina Bertini. Mariolina Bertini si è occupata di letteratura e cultura nel senso più ampio del termine integrando lo studio della letteratura francese, che ha insegnato per decenni all’Università di Parma, con una costante attenzione verso altre letterature, e senza distinzione di genere. Basterebbero gli studi su Balzac e Proust, le edizioni di Stendhal, Flaubert o ancora di Proust e Balzac, le introduzioni a Dumas e Colette, e gli articoli su altri autori e temi a delinearne il profilo di studiosa che ha completato con una complementare, e intensa, attività militante

    Virées littéraires dans les récits de voyage de Jean-Claude Charles

    No full text
    C'est Jean-Claude Charles lecteur que nous avons choisi de traquer dans ces pages. Nous l'avons suivi au cours de ses déplacements dans les différents continents qu'il arpente. Ses voyages sont l'occasion pour l'écrivain de solliciter des auteurs et des oeuvres qui habitent les territoires parcourus. Les récits proposent un intertexte très riche, nous nous proposons de limiter notre enquete, quant aux écrivains que Charles convoque, à l'espace étasunien. Nous essaierons de montrer comment Charles procède, dans la mise en forme de ces récits, à un double voyage, spatial et littéraire et comments ces deux voyages s'autoalimentent et s'expliquent tour à tour
